Conversion Cost

The combined cost of direct labor and manufacturing overheads, representing the total expense to convert raw materials into finished goods.

Transferred-In Materials

The costs of materials that were processed in a prior production department and then moved to a subsequent process or department.

Process Cost Accounting

A method of accounting used in manufacturing environments to allocate costs to products based on the processes they go through.
